It means that the main Twitter’s question “What's happening?” becomes more precise – “What's happening? (and where?)”; users get the possibility to define from what point on the planet they are tweeting, and if something happens everybody will know not only about the episode (such as an earthquake), but also about its location.
Twitter
announced its plans to unveil this feature in summer.
As for the sum of the agreement, it is undisclosed.